The Hypersonic Attack Cruise Missile (HACM), developed by Raytheon Missiles and Defense in collaboration with Northrop Grumman, is an air-launched, scramjet-powered hypersonic weapon. Hypersonic missiles are able to fly at speeds of Mach 5 or greater, which is five times the speed of sound. Raytheon Missiles & Defense and Northrop Grumman announced the second successful flight test of their Hypersonic Air-breathing Weapon Concept, or HAWC, on Monday (July 18).According to the two ...The SM-6 missile is three missiles in one. It's the only weapon that can perform anti-air warfare, ballistic missile defense and anti-surface warfare missions.
